Abstract:
The author reviews "Jewish Women and Their Salons: The Power of Conversation", an exhibit which was shown at the Jewish Museum (New York) and the McMullen Museum of Art at Boston College. The exhibit drew on a variety of historical sources, including letters, diaries, paintings and literature. The author explains that the exhibit illustrates and enhances the important contributions of women's history and gender studies to the field of Jewish studies.
